The Turnabout Shop is a small, "boutique" thrift store, staffed entirely by volunteers who perform the following: culling and pricing donations, placing priced items on the floor, straightening and decorating the shop, operating the cash register, assisting customers and donors, and doing anything else that comes up in the course of the day. All volunteers must join the Berkeley Clinic Auxiliary (BCA), which is the organization that operates the Turnabout (the membership dues are $20 annually). Volunteers also have the option to serve on the Board of the BCA, which meets bi-monthly to discuss any issues that arise pertaining to the shop and to determine a course of action by a majority vote. There is a luncheon 4 times a year, where members can enjoy dining, socializing and hearing news about the shop.
